Elevate your living space with our Luxury Vintage French Lace Jacquard Chenille Blackout Pinch Double Pleats Drapes. Crafted from premium chenille jacquard, these drapes feature intricate French lace-inspired patterns that exude sophistication and timeless elegance. The pinch double pleats create a tailored, luxurious drape while ensuring smooth movement on your rod. Designed for superior blackout performance, they block sunlight, enhance privacy, and reduce noise, making them perfect for bedrooms, living rooms, or studies. Luxury and functionality combine beautifully in every panel.

A double pinch pleat (two-finger pleat) creates a refined, tailored aesthetic that bridges the gap between classic formality and modern simplicity. It produces a crisp, architectural drape that looks elegant without being overly busy, making it the perfect choice for contemporary homes that desire a luxury vintage touch.

Our designs use professional jacquard weaving, where the lace motif is physically integrated into the dense chenille fabric structure. This creates a rich, multi-dimensional texture and superior colorfastness, ensuring the pattern remains vibrant and does not peel or crack over time.

Yes. These drapes are crafted from heavy-weight, high-density chenille and paired with an opaque, premium blackout thermal lining. This multi-layered construction blocks over 95% of sunlight, ensuring total privacy and creating the dark environment necessary for restorative sleep.

These drapes are designed for use with curtain tracks or traverse rods with rings. Each panel comes with adjustable pin hooks pre-inserted into the pleat tape. Simply insert these hooks into the eyelets on your track gliders or curtain rings for a professional, perfectly aligned installation.

Absolutely. The dense chenille construction and the integrated blackout backing act as a powerful thermal insulator. These drapes help retain indoor warmth during winter and block out excessive solar heat during summer, contributing to better energy efficiency and climate control in your home.

Yes. The heavy, substantial weight of the chenille fabric and the layered blackout lining provide excellent acoustic absorption. While they do not offer total soundproofing, they are highly effective at dampening exterior street noise, making your room significantly quieter and more tranquil.

To maintain the intricate texture of the lace jacquard and the structural integrity of the pleats, we strongly recommend professional dry cleaning. Avoid machine washing, as the agitation can distort the pleats and potentially damage the blackout thermal backing.

It is normal for heavy, high-quality drapery to arrive with minor creases. After hanging your panels, use a handheld fabric steamer on the front side of the fabric. The natural weight of the drapes will help gravity pull the pleats taut, and the steam will release any remaining wrinkles within 24 hours.
